Portugal and France will square off Friday in Hamburg with a place in the Euro 2024 semifinals on the line.
Portugal is coming after an unimpressive clash with Slovenia, Ronaldo’s side needing a penalty shootout to edge that one after neither team managed to score in 120 minutes of play. After previously losing 0-2 to Georgia, Portugal badly needs to regain its early tournament form ahead of this clash against the mighty French.
However, the mighty French aren’t looking particularly spectacular either. The 1-0 Round of 16 win against Belgium was solid, but it was a largely unimpressive tournament so far for Les Bleus, who have struggled to create danger offensively.
Team news & lineups:
Portugal is at full strength, while France will miss Rabiot, suspended.
Portugal: Costa – Cancelo, Pepe, Dias, Mendes – Vitinha, Palhinha – Silva, Fernandes, Leao – Ronaldo
France: Maignan – Kounde, Upamecano, Saliba, Hernandez – Kante, Tchouameni – Dembele, Griezmann, Mbappe – Thuram
Portugal looked clueless offensively against Slovenia, while France has been unable to score more than one goal in a match for the entire tournament (1-0, 0-0, 1-1, 1-0).
When you add the results of these two teams so far, we have six matches with under 2,5 goals from the eight they played.
I think this has the makings of a low scoring game. It’s a tight clash with a lot at stake, both sides have defended well and neither has really found its form at front despite the obvious quality of the attacking players.
For what it’s worth, 4 of the last 5 meetings ended with under 2,5 goals. The previous clash was a 2-2 draw at Euro 2021, but even that match had two penalties to push it over 2,5 goals.
